Jeffrey Epstein killed himself in his cell

The State ruled Epstein committed suicide, while his private lawyers claim murder.

The State ruled Epstein committed suicide, while his private lawyers claim murder.Convicted sex offender and financier Jeffery Epstein was arrested in July 2019. Weeks after, he attempted suicide in his cell after being denied bail. He was treated at a local hospital before being returned to the Metropolitan Correctional Center in New York.

He was pronounced dead on being found unconscious on what the state ruled to be a second suicide attempt just before his trial. He was not on suicide watch despite warning signs. His private lawyers and a pathologist hired by his brother Dr. Baden, however, claim that he was murdered due to "unusual fractures" found on his neck in the autopsy and claiming he was in danger from other inmates. This has fuelled conspiracy theories about his murder, leading the FBI to probe if his death was "the result of a criminal enterprise" due to his high profile connections and involvements. The medical examiner's office, however, stands "firmly" by their finding that it was a suicide hanging.
